Hike Club

The RRA Hike Club is a great way to experience Greater Sudbury trails in a fun, safe and friendly environment. Led by an experienced hiker, different trails are selected for each hike to help you discover Greater Sudbury's trail network. Hikes typically run the first Saturday of each month and are free of charge. The location and flavour of each hike changes month to month and is dependent on seasons, hike leaders, and... well, whichever way the volunteer team takes it!

To help us run smooth events, online registration and waivers are required by each participant for each hike. By registering, you'll receive a reminder email the day before, and/or be notified of any last minute changes or cancelations. Hikes run in all but the very worst of weather so please come prepared with proper footwear and clothing.
